    Hello,

    It appears that my app doesn’t display the verge3d part.
    It happens maybe 20% of the time. I need to reload the page until it works fine.
    I would guess there is a conflict somewhere but I have no idea where to look..

    First, disable “Fit to canvas” constraint. It’s not working in your app (ready_button is not a direct child of the camera). Then press F12, switch to the mobile view and see errors.

    I haven’t been able to find where to disable “Fit to canvas” constraint.

    In Blender. Object -> Verge3D settings -> Fit to Camera Edge.
